#13f598 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#13f598 is composed of 7.5% red, 96.1%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 92.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 38% yellow and 3.9% black. It has a hue angle of 155.3 degrees, a saturation of 91.9% and a lightness of 51.8%. #13f598 color hex could be obtained by blending #26ffff with #00eb31. Closest websafe color is: #00ff99.

#13f598 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#13f598 has RGB values of R:19, G:245,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.92, M:0, Y:0.38,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 1308056.

Shades and Tints of #13f598
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000905 is the darkest color, while #f5fffb is the lightest one.
